Abstract (en)

[origin: GB2263537A] A machine piercing a taphole for a shaft furnace by the lost rod method comprises a mounting (20), with a support (52) installed on the mounting so as to support the rod (26) at the front of the mounting (20) and a rear support (30) which can move on the mounting. The rear support is provided with means for being coupled to the rear end of the rod (26). A clamp (34) is mounted in a sliding manner on the mounting and is designed to grip the rod (25) at any place between the said front support (32) and the said rear support (20). A powerful rotary motor (42) installed at the rear of the mounting (20) drives an endless chain (44) installed axially in the mounting (20). The clamp (34) is connected to a carriage 36 which is attached to the endless chain (44). During the insertion of the rod into the taphole clay, repeated reversal of the direction of rotation of the motor (42) coupled with synchronous opening and closing of the clamp 34 is effective to drive the rod into place in a step-wise fashion. <IMAGE>
